Transaction 57f56cfa9bbe80380a927dc5592bd7a258eeaf70665d578a8b0fccc52fd43497
1 Input
1 Output
-
57f56cfa9bbe80380a927dc5592bd7a258eeaf70665d578a8b0fccc52fd43497:0
- value
- 196738628
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ed5e4685a3ce24c88ffdcd134847576367b535b9
- address
- bc1qa40ydpdrecjv3rlae5f5s36hvdnm2dde5u837a